General Notes (Husband)
Shoshenq III was the seventh king of the Twenty-seco n d D y n asty. He is thought to have ruled for fifty-two y ea rs . Du ri ng the twenty-eighth year of his reign, an Ap i s bul l wa s bo rn. This is recorded on the Serapeum ste l a by a p ries t name d Pediese. His tomb was found at Tan i s and wa s simil ar in s tructure to those of Psusenne s I a nd Osorko n II. General Notes (Husband)
Thutmose I, king of Egypt (1524-1518 BC) of the ear l y 1 8 t h Dynasty, successor of his brother-in-law, Amenh o t e p I . A noted soldier and commander of the armed forc e s , Th utmo se I reconquered the Nubians of northern Afri c a a nd la ter a dvanced into Asia as far as the Euphrate s R iver . Th e remain der of his reign was devoted to vari ou s build ing p rojects . At Karnak he built two pylons (g ate way buil dings ) and a h ypostyle hall and raised two o beli sks, on e of whi ch is stil l standing. Source: "Thutm ose I ," Micro soft(R) E ncarta(R) 9 8 Encyclopedia. (c) 19 93-199 7 Microso ft Corpora tion. All ri ghts reserved. --- --- Th e third kin g of the 18 th Dynasty wa s a commoner b y birth . He had mar ried Ahmose , a sister of A menhotep I , and wa s named kin g when the kin g died childless . Ahmo se bore h im two son s who were passe d over for Thutmo s e II, who wa s born to M utnofret. Thutmos e built an ext ensio n to th e temple of Am on at Karnak. He a dded pylons , court s an d statues. He le d a campaign into Nu bia wher e he penetr a ted beyond the Th ird Cataract. He defe ate d the Nubian chi e f in a hand to h and combat and return e d to Thebes wit h th e body of the fa llen chief hangin g on t he prow of hi s ship . His greates t campaigns wer e in the De lta. Warrin g agains t the Hykso s he subdued t ribes and fina lly reach ed the Euph rates Riv er. To comme morate his victor y he bu ilt a hypostyl e hal l at Karnak , made entirely of ce dar w ood columns. Hi s rem ains wer e found in the cache, wit h o thers, at Deir e l Bah ri. Th utmose brought Egypt a sen s e of stability and hi s m ilit ary campaigns healed the wo und s of Thebians. General Notes (Husband)
Xerxes I (Persian Khshayarsha) (circa 519-465 BC) , k i n g o f Persia (486-465 BC), the son of Darius I an d Atos s a ( flou rished 6th century BC), daughter of Cyru s the Gr ea t. A scend ing the throne upon the death of hi s father , h e subdu ed a r ebellion in Egypt, and then spe nt thre e year s prepar ing a g reat fleet and army to puni sh the G reeks f or aidin g the Ion ian cities in 498 BC an d for the ir victo ry over t he Persian s at Marathon in 49 0 BC. Th e Greek his torian Her odotus give s as the combin ed streng th of Xerxes ' land an d naval force s the incred ible tota l of 2,641,61 0 warriors , but it was pr obably b etween 200 ,000 and 300,0 00. Xerxe s is said to hav e cros sed the Hel lespont by a br idge of bo ats more than a k il ometer in le ngth and to hav e cut a cana l through the ist h mus of Moun t ΓΒthos. Durin g the spring o f 480 BC he ma rche d with hi s forces throug h Thrace, Thessa ly, and Loc ris. A t Thermo pylae 300 Sparta ns, under their k ing, Leo nidas I, a nd 11 00 other Greeks m ade a courageous b ut fu tile stand, de la ying the Persian s for ten days. Xerx e s then advanced in t o Attica and burn ed Athens, which h ad b een abandoned b y th e Greeks. At th e Battle of Salam ΓΒs late r in 480 BC , however , his fleet w as defeated b y a continge nt of Gre ek warship s commanded b y the Athen ian Themistocle s. Xerx es thereupo n retired t o Asia Mino r, leaving his arm y i n Greece under t he comman d of hi s brother-in-law, Mardo n ius, who was slai n at Plat aea t he following year. Xerx e s was murdered at Per sepoli s b y Artabanus, captain of t h e palace guard; he was s ucce e ded by his son Artaxerxe s I ( reigned 465-425 BC). Xer x e s is generally identifie d as th e Ahasuerus of the Bo o k o f Esther. Source: "Xerxe s I," Mic rosoft(R) Encarta( R ) 98 En cyclopedia. (c) 1993- 1997 Micros oft Corporation . General Notes (Husband)
BIRTH & BAPTISM: Sturm s/o Isac Falck and Maria; spo n s o r s: HenrichWerner and Catherina Z a he; Church reco rd
MARRIAGE: no known record
NOTE: as of May 1813, Storm is shown as having a wi f e E s t her, andchildren Sophia, Isaac, Jacob, Peter, Cat ha rin e , Ti ce and Lena. They are receiving rations as fa mil y o f m an b elonging to Capt Charles Askins Company i n the Wa r of 1 812 . (Natio n al Archives: Charles Askin s Papers , M 6 19A 3 Vol 41; Women and Children names belon gin g t o m e n of Ca pt Ask ins Company)
